Merrick Bank . This position focuses on email marketing and broader digital marketing initiatives to drive customer engagement. The ideal candidate will have hands-on experience with Salesforce Marketing Cloud and email optimization tools, with a strong preference for candidates who have worked in the financial services industry. Key Responsibilities Design, build, and execute email marketing campaigns using Salesforce Marketing Cloud, including automation workflows, triggered campaigns, and customer journey mapping. Develop and maintain email templates and dynamic content to support marketing initiatives across different customer segments. Utilize Litmus for comprehensive email testing across multiple devices, email clients, and browsers to ensure deliverability and user experience. Conduct A/B testing on subject lines, content, send times, and campaign elements to improve performance metrics. Collaborate with cross-functional teams to create compelling email content that aligns with brand guidelines and regulatory requirements. Monitor and analyze campaign performance metrics to provide actionable insights and recommendations. Manage email database segmentation and list hygiene to maintain high deliverability rates and compliance with industry regulations.
Requirements
Bachelor's degree in Marketing, Communications, or related field 5+ years of experience in email marketing with demonstrated success in campaign management Advanced proficiency in Salesforce Marketing Cloud, including Journey Builder, Email Studio, and Automation Studio Experience with Litmus or similar email testing and optimization platforms Strong analytical skills with experience in email performance reporting and data analysis Knowledge of HTML/CSS for email template customization Understanding of email deliverability best practices and anti-spam regulation
Preferred Qualifications
Previous experience in financial services, banking, insurance, or fintech industries Knowledge of financial services regulations and compliance requirements Familiarity with CRM integration and data management platforms Experience with advanced segmentation and personalization strategies
